Surely you have ever found yourself in a situation where you have to do something at night or in places with poor lighting and you have your hands full. This motion sensor headlamp can help solve this issue. This is an adjustable headlamp with motion sensor and 270°wide angle illumination that gives you a greater range. Just wave your hand at the sensor and then the lamp will be switch on or off. Suitable for cycling, hiking, reading, fishing, and other outdoor activities.

Features:
  • Motion Sensor& Hand-free Light: Press the sensor switch to enter sensor mode. Then you can easily turn on or off the light simply by waving your hand at the sensor, even with gloves on. Extremely convenient and effectively avoid dirtying the lamp when your hands get dirty.
  • 270° Illumination & 1000 Lumens: Featured with 270° wide-angle illumination and a maximum brightness of 1000lm, it can easily light up a tent, tunnel, road, and etc.. The built-in lithium battery can work for 4hrs after being fully charged. You can charge it via any power supply with USB port.
  • 6 Light Modes: This headlamp is equipped with 6 light modes, including COB mode (high/low/strobe) and XPG spotlight(high/low/strobe). Short press the switch button to cycle through various modes to meet your various needs. Besides, the XPG spotlight can be rotated 90°to adjust the lighting angle.
  • IPX5 Waterproof: Reaching IPX5 waterproof rate, this headlamp can be used outdoors on rainy or snowy days. Suitable for camping, night running, car repair and etc..
  • Adjustable Elastic Band & Battery Indicators: The elastic band can be adjusted to perfectly fit your head and the contact area features a soft pad, bringing you a comfortable and stable lighting experience. 4 Indicators can show the real-time battery status to remind you of charging it in time. No need to worry about light going out suddenly.
